Boston-based sensor company Teradar is debuting its flagship terahertz sensor, called Summit, at the Consumer Electronics Show 2026. The company is positioning the solid-state sensor—which is a sensor with no moving parts—as a solution to the limitations of legacy radar and lidar (light detection and ranging sensor technology). By leveraging the relatively unused terahertz band of the electromagnetic spectrum, which sits between microwaves and infrared, the sensor is designed to deliver high performance in any weather condition. However, actually getting the technology onto the road remains conditional: the sensor will start shipping in 2028 if Teradar can lock down contracts with automakers.

Teradar is entering a highly volatile automotive sensor market characterized by severe financial distress and consolidation among Western players, contrasted with rapid scaling in China:

  • Luminar: The U.S. lidar company filed for bankruptcy protection in December after contracts with automakers fell apart.
  • Ouster and Velodyne: These competitors underwent a wave of consolidation, resulting in Velodyne merging with Ouster, which subsequently diversified into other potential markets like robotics and smart infrastructure.
  • Hesai: In contrast to struggling Western firms, the Chinese lidar company announced in October that it had built more than 1 million lidar sensors in 2025.

To navigate this challenging landscape, Teradar is backed by a $150 million Series B fundraise. The round included funding from Lockheed Martin, a defense company with a venture arm, and VXI Capital, a defense-focused venture fund. Teradar is currently working to prove its technology with five top automakers from the U.S. and Europe, alongside three Tier 1 suppliers—which act as direct suppliers to automotive OEMs.

CEO Matt Carey, who spoke about the company’s strategy in November, is prioritizing broad automotive integration. “Our main job is to make sure our sensor gets on all automobiles, and whatever the best way to do that is, that’s what we’re going to pursue,” Carey said. While some automakers are still integrating lidar—such as Rivian, which in December announced plans to integrate a roof-mounted lidar sensor in its upcoming R2 SUV—Teradar is betting that its terahertz-band technology can offer a more reliable, weather-resistant alternative.
